Refreshing lemonade to make at anytime of the year, but especially to cool off when the temperatures rise.
INGREDIENTS:
1 cup sugar (can reduce to 3/4 cup)
1 tbsp chopped, fresh ginger
1 cup water (for simple syrup)
1 cup Lemon Juice
4 cups Water, Cold to dilute
DIRECTIONS:
1. Make simple syrup by heating the sugar, adding a tablespoon of chopped, fresh ginger, and water in a small saucepan until the sugar is dissolved completely.
2. While the sugar is dissolving, use a juicer to extract the juice from 4 to 6 lemons, enough for one cup of juice.
3. Add the juice and the sugar-water to a pitcher. Add 3 to 4 cups of cold water, more or less to the desired strength. Refrigerate 30 to 40 minutes. If the lemonade is a little sweet for your taste, add a little more straight lemon juice to it.
4. Serve with ice, sliced lemons.
Servings: 6
Serving Ideas: Add sliced strawberries or blueberries to the final lemonade.
